My wife, 5 month old son and I had a great time at the vasia beach.The rooms were very clean, of a good size and had everything you could need. The restaurant was very good with a fantastic array of very good food. The staff were all very helpful and made a real fuss of our son. The village of sisi is very pretty and there is a lovely atmosphere there. The hotels only problem is that there arent really enough pools, there is no beach within the immediate vicinity and there arent enough bars for an all inclusive joint. But dont that let you be put off from what is an otherwise fantastic place where we had a great time and the staff were very good.

As booking a last minute deal, we wanted to make sure we read comments made on trip advisor about this hotel and we were overall happy except for a few negative comments. As with all comments made on trip advisor, there will always be unhappy travellers, but we decided to go for it.

All we can say, having just returned from a week at this fabulous hotel, is 'WOW'! We arrived at 4 in the morning and the reception staff were extremely friendly and helpful (as they were throughout our stay) having just travelled hours from Gatwick and immediately we were given a bag of fresh fruit, bottles of water and a couple of freshly made baguettes. Exactly what we needed after a tiring journey.

Our bags were taken to our room and having requested a sea view room, we were more than happy. Our superior room was very well located - excellent decor, very clean, outstanding facilites and we were very impressed.

Our deal included the 'All Inclusive' package and we did not stop eating for the whole holiday! We're not fatties by any stretch of the imagination, but the quality of the food was outstanding. The main buffet restaurant had a vast amount of different food catering for everyone and there were 4 other restaurants you can eat at once during your stay. The Italian was 'excellent', the Greek and Chinese were 'very good' and we were fortunate enough to eat at the exclusive '1996 restaurant' which was out of this world! There is an extra charge to eat here but it is worth every penny - you can't beat a six course meal overlooking a beautiful sunset. That apart, there's a snack bar you can eat at as well that has burgers/pizzas/greek salads etc and of course the soft drinks as well. Drinks were great, but as with most hotels, they pour too much alcohol in, but that's just standard for Greece! Local wine not that impressive, but wine list was and we more than happy to buy a bottle of decent wine to accomplish our evening food.

We were amazed by the number of pools available and each with a different contrast. Obviously there were a number of families with young children splashing water and having fun, but that's part of what you expect. There were smaller and quieter pools that we sunbathed at right by the seafront and it was very refreshing with the sea breeze. Perfect for couples. If you want to pay extra, you can even have your private pool!

Hotel Entertainment was okay but not something to write home about - there was a nightclub called 'Aquarium' that was great for the teenagers and younger couples to go to but short walks in to the little fishing village took our fancy and we found some good little bars etc to go to.

The Spa and Gym had good facilities but with 35 degrees outside, it was hardly worth a visit especially as we hadn't seen the sun for a year! Plus the spa had additional charges which we felt weren't worth it.

All in all, we were so impressed, we have decided to go again next year and take friends and family. Not everyone would have had the same experience as us, but it is what you make it that counts and if you get a good deal, we strongly recommend you stay at this wonderful 5* hotel. We've stayed in a few and this was up there with the best.

Great time but this is a really a 4 star as stated throughout other reviews. But the hotel has a great feel and contemporary design.

Food is great: you can eat at the Chinese (Ok) Greek (OK+) and Italian (Good) once per week stay on the all inclusive tariff as well as the main buffet restaurant. Salads are superb but also a good mix of meat, fish, chicken with different veg. Snack bar is good too with pizza, burger, 3 different types of pre packed salads. My wife is really fussy and she loved the buffet.

You will queue for dinner but no longer than 15 minutes (grab a drink from the bar). Here's a tip, get to the bar 5 minutes before the restaurant opens, grab a beer and join the queue. You'll wait no longer than 5 - 10 minutes this way.

Spotless hotel, great service, great rooms; did I say that the staff are lovely. Only problem is that the drinks are really watered down. But really that is the only problem we had which was outweighed by the positives.

The gym is great - free to use up to 2pm and 5 euro after that. Weights, running machines x trainers, plasma screens etc.

There is a small beach 3 minutes walk away (which is great for a dip in the harbour) but for a great beach take the free hotel mini bus to the beach 5 minutes away and then walk a 100 yards or so up the road and take the next beech. Cross over the cliffs on your right (not too precarious but be careful) and you'll find a long wonderful dream beach with great views over Malia with the hills to the back of you. Sunbeds are 4 Euros for the day. Make sure you order a free packed lunch to take with you.

Also at the back of the hotel there is a small promenade overlooking the sea, head down at sunset; great watching the crashing waves with a loved one :) ;)

If the world was smaller I'd definitely go back. we paid £530 each including flights and transfers - worth every penny

We stayed at the Vasia Beach Hotel for a week from 22nd June 2008. We had a great holiday and loved Sissi, but I want to be completely honest about the hotel, which in my opinion does not live up to its 5* rating at peak times as the staff and facilites are not geared up to cope with so many people.

The hotel building itself wasn't particularly impressive with basic reception area and main restaurant, which struggled to seat all the guest and meant queing for breakfast and dinner and on cocassion sharing your table with people who did not speak the same language as you (this happened twice to us and we had to que). The restaurants on the sea front had lovely views and you could watch the sun set, but as with the main restauarant the food was all buffet style and help yourself. The All inclusive drinks were very basic and the alcohol was watered down!

We upgraded our room to a superior double with sea view and this was very nice with big bathrom and both shower and bath in marble, the only complaint I would have about the room is that the fridge was never re-stocked during our stay and we had to pay 30Euro for the use of the safe, which when I have stayed 5 * elsewhere has been included in the price and the fridge is usually restocked every day.

There were 5 pools in total, but unfortunately none of this were adult only and as we had travelled as a couple in peak season meant we had to share the pools with lots of children and families jumping in and playing with inflatables, which meant we couldn't really relax and I couldn't swim lengths without crashing into someone or being splashed in the face, however this would be fine if you were a family, just not great for a couple on a romantic break!

There was a small beach in Sissi next to the port and this was lovely, crystal clear waters and extremeley still. There was also a very nice beach on the road to Malia from Siss which was used by the loclas, golden sands and still clear water again, gorgeous, we spent quite a few days there.

We hired a car and tralled over to Elouda one day, which was really nice for a change and had fresh fish on the port.

All in all I did enjoy the holiday and Crete but was disappointed with the hotel as expected more for 5 * and would have liked it to have been a lot quieter during the day and at feed times (Sissi itself is very quiet at night). I would go to Sissi again, but would settle for a 4 * at a lower price!

Hope this helps and I've not been too negative just trying to be honest!

I stayed I this hotel with my wife, 18 year old daughter and boyfriend. We booked after reading the reviews on Tripadvisor and if anything the hotel was better than expected. The staff are very helpful and professional - anything found in need of attention was entered into the maintenance system and seen to that day. The entire site is beautifully maintained to high standard and I have never seen a hotel with so many swimming pools. The rooms are very well furnished and air-conditioned with bed linen changed daily.
All of the restaurants we sampled were very good if not excellent. In the main restaurant there was something for everyone and all food was to a high standard. The head chef d'cuisine visits all the restaurants during the day, it appears, and is always to be seen in the main one at evening meal times. This pays dividends, especially when you see how many people turn up between 1900 and 2100 to be fed. I got the feeling that there was a well-oiled organisation working behind the scenes. We had a very enjoyable stay and would definitely return again.
